The role involves providing technical consultation, designing, and delivering complex data storage solutions related to replication, clustering, cloud offerings, and data migrations, supporting sales efforts and ensuring successful implementation for customers across various platforms and environments.
Key Responsibilities
Design and implement replication, clustering, and data migration solutions for customers.
Provide technical consultation and support to sales teams and customers during pre-sales and post-sales phases.
Participate in customer evaluations, proof of concepts, and project planning for technical solutions.
Develop scripts to automate processes related to storage integration, replication, clustering, and data migrations.
Evaluate partner proposals to ensure quality and value in migration services.
Support the delivery of complex technical projects across various environments and platforms.
Advise on engineering strategies for replication, clustering, and data migration to meet disaster recovery and business continuity needs.
